Extraction and Physicochemical Characterization of Oil from Maringa Stenopetala Seeds

Abstract

The moringa stenopetala seed used for extraction of oil were collected from Arbaminch town in southern and south western of Ethiopia. The seed were prepared for use by removing the pods, drying with oven and milled to flour. A soxhlet extraction was used for extraction of the oil with petroleum; the oil was recovered by simple distillation using Rota evaporater. The residual oil obtained was characterized by investigating physico-chemical parameters and result shows that the extracted oils were liquid at room temperature, pale yellow colour and odorless.the results were average Seed Weight (g) (0.42), moisture content (5.7%), average density (0.907), fibre (7.50), protein (30.90), viscosity (10%), PH (7.53), acid value (1.68), saponification value (178), iodine value (70.2), peroxide value (9.45), yield of oil (47.8 %). This result of analysis confirms the standard specification and reveals that the extracted oil has good quality and food additives as well as industrial purposes and commercial applications.
